Scientist Jason Drake (Carradine) has been holed up deep within a secret island laboratory of an unscrupulous biotech corporation. Doing what? Meddling with the laws of nature, of course! When he turns his attention from mutating fruits and vegetables to alligators, crocodiles and dinosaurs,… More

  • Tim S


    Dinocroc vs. Supergator is exactly what you expect it to be: made-for-tv schlock with no creativity, style or filmmaking skill. It doesn't matter that David Carradine is in it or that Roger Corman spearheaded and presented it. It's terrible, and not in a good way. Skip it… More
